In the morning, start your adventure by visiting the Gateway of India, an iconic monument and one of Mumbai's most popular tourist attractions. Marvel at its grand architecture and take a boat ride to Elephanta Caves,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, located on an island near Mumbai. Spend the afternoon exploring the Sanjay Gandhi National Park, home to diverse wildlife, scenic trails, and the ancient Kanheri Caves. In the evening, visit Marine Drive, fondly known as the "Queen's Necklace," and enjoy a leisurely stroll along the promenade while overlooking the Arabian Sea.
Start your day with a visit to the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Vastu Sangrahalaya (formerly Prince of Wales Museum), a marvelous museum showcasing a vast collection of art, artifacts, and historical exhibits. Explore the nearby Jehangir Art Gallery, renowned for its contemporary Indian art. For a family-friendly afternoon, head to EsselWorld, India's largest amusement park, featuring thrilling rides, water slides, and entertainment options for all ages. In the evening, stroll through the vibrant Colaba Causeway market, filled with local handicrafts, clothing, and street food.
Spend your morning discovering the historic Bandra Fort, offering panoramic views of the Arabian Sea. Next, visit the nearby Mount Mary Basilica, a sacred Catholic church revered by locals. In the afternoon, wander around the bustling Crawford Market, known for its vibrant atmosphere, spices, and fresh produce. A visit to the nearby Chor Bazaar, a famous flea market, is a must for unique finds. Wrap up the day by enjoying a sunset at Bandstand Promenade, a popular waterfront stretch.
Embark on a morning tour of Film City, a famous complex where Bollywood movies are made. Explore the studio sets, see behind-the-scenes action, and perhaps spot a celebrity. Enjoy a delicious lunch at a nearby local eatery. In the afternoon, visit the Nehru Science Centre, a science museum housing interactive exhibits and a planetarium. Conclude the day by rejuvenating at Juhu Beach, a vibrant coastline known for its street food stalls and spectacular sunset views.
Start your day by visiting the beautiful Haji Ali Dargah, an impressive mosque and tomb situated on a small islet in the Arabian Sea. Marvel at its exquisite architecture and serene surroundings. Afterward, explore the Kamala Nehru Park, known for its lush greenery and captivating views of the city. Enjoy a picnic lunch amidst nature. In the afternoon, head to Global Vipassana Pagoda, a magnificent golden dome dedicated to meditation. Conclude your trip by embracing the tranquility of Hanging Gardens, a terraced garden providing scenic vistas.
When exploring Mumbai, don't miss the fascinating street art scene in Bandra, a suburb known for its vibrant culture. Take a stroll down the streets and uncover hidden masterpieces. For an offbeat experience, visit the Kanheri Caves during the early hours to enjoy the tranquil surroundings away from the crowds. Additionally, don't forget to try local street food delicacies like vada pav, pav bhaji, and pani puri. These flavorful snacks can be found at various food stalls throughout the city.
